As a former member of the CONIFA ExCo for 3 years, I can say categorically that the organisation has no insight to offer on the subject of being anti-racist. https://twitter.com/alansavunmasi_/status/1309919414775623680
Unless they want to talk about a player reporting racial abuse at the WFC 2018 and a credible witness being harassed along with anyone who wanted an open investigation.
Or a current member of the ExCo stating that racist comments are ‘often just banter on the football field’.
It’s very easy to crow about being anti-racist but the proof is in actions, not words. If a well-connected CONIFA member is accused of racism will it be given a full and proper investigation? I seriously doubt it now those of us who fought for that are gone.
If CONIFA was asking for help to do better on racism then I’d respect that, but professing expertise shows exactly the arrogance that means it will never improve.
There are many organisations doing important work in this space, @farenet or @kickitout to name but two. CONIFA should be listening, not talking.
